This office lease form is a provision from a negotiated perspective. The landlord shall provide to the tenant in substantial detail each year the calculations, accounts and averages performed to determine the building operating costs.
Harris Texas Tenant Audit Provision Fairer Negotiated Provision is a legal clause that aims to ensure fair and transparent financial dealings between landlords and tenants in Harris County, Texas. This provision is designed to protect the rights and interests of both parties involved in a lease agreement, ensuring that landlords accurately and honestly report and allocate expenses related to the tenant's rental property. Under the Harris Texas Tenant Audit Provision Fairer Negotiated Provision, tenants are granted the right to request and conduct audits on the expenses declared by the landlord. This provision enables tenants to verify the accuracy of the expenses allocated to them and ensures that they are not unfairly burdened with excessive charges. The Harris Texas Tenant Audit Provision Fairer Negotiated Provision promotes integrity in financial transactions by increasing transparency and accountability. It prevents landlords from overcharging tenants or misappropriating funds through concealed expenses, thus avoiding potential disputes and fostering a more harmonious landlord-tenant relationship. Different types of Harris Texas Tenant Audit Provision Fairer Negotiated Provision may include variations on the degree of audit allowed, timelines for conducting audits, and the procedure for resolving disputes that arise during the audit process. Some provisions may require tenants to provide reasonable evidence supporting their audit claims, such as receipts or other relevant documentation.
